In Buffalo, New York, the heart of the American rust-belt, the public school system pays for its teachers to get plastic surgery. Hair removal. Miscrodermabrasian. Liposuction. If you can name the procedure, it's probably covered.

No, I am not exaggerating. And no, this article is not an excuse to make "Hot For Teacher" cracks. When I write that Buffalo's school system pays, I mean it literally. The perk is included as a self-insured rider in its teachers' contract. Therefore, the district has to cover the cost of each nip and tuck itself. There's no co-pay, so the school district ends up footing the entire bill. It estimates the current annual cost at $5.2 million, down from $9 million in 2009.

In January, Ohioan Kelley Williams-Bolar was sentenced to 10 days in jail, three years of probation, and 80 hours of community service for having her children attend schools outside her district. Gov. John Kasich reduced her sentence last month.

Ms. Williams-Bolar caught a break last month when Ohio Gov. John Kasich granted her clemency, reducing her charges to misdemeanors from felonies. His decision allows her to pursue her teacher's license, and it may provide hope to parents beyond the Buckeye State. In the last year, parents in Connecticut, Kentucky and Missouri have all been arrested—and await sentencing—for enrolling their children in better public schools outside of their districts.

A long-anticipated decision has finally been handed down by the Fifth U.S. Circuit Court of Appeals in the infamous "candy cane" case.

 

The court ruled yesterday that the Plano (Texas) Independent School District violated the Constitution by not allowing student Jonathan Morgan to hand out candy cane pens with a religious message at his class "winter" party nine years ago. According to the ruling, a little girl who was threatened for handing out tickets to a religious play, as well as an entire class of children who were forbidden from writing "Merry Christmas" on holiday cards to American troops overseas, also suffered discrimination.

When voters reject a school district's proposed budget, state law allows the district to operate under a "contingency" budget of its previous budget plus 120 percent of the prior year's inflation rate. But last year's CPI was slightly negative -- so voters can actually lower their school-property-tax bills by nixing the budget.

That is, a "no" vote could actually mean something.

More than 22,620 Texas secondary students who stopped showing up for class in 2008 were excluded from the state's dropout statistics because administrators said they were being home-schooled, according to Texas Education Agency figures.

But that's where the scrutiny of this growing population seems to end, leaving some experts convinced that schools are disguising thousands of middle and high school dropouts in this hands-off category.

While home-schooling's popularity has increased, the rate of growth concentrated in Texas' high school population is off the chart: It's nearly tripled in the last decade, including a 24 percent jump in a single year.

“That's just ridiculous,” said Brian D. Ray, founder of the National Home Education Research Institute. “It doesn't sound very believable.”
